Thomas Tuchel will be hoping his England side can correct some of the mistakes from Saturday's "freestyle" display against a resilient New Zealand, as the Three Lions prepare to face Costa Rica.
The England manager was clearly dissatisfied with his team's performance in Tampa, though there were some extenuating factors. Goalscorer Harry Kane and Jude Bellingham both highlighted the challenging conditions and a below-standard pitch, which hampered England's passing game against a defensively compact opponent.

Costa Rica will look to cause similar headaches to the All Whites by sitting deep and denying space in and around the penalty area. The 2014 World Cup quarterfinalists missed out on qualification for the upcoming tournament after finishing behind Haiti and Honduras in their third-round group.
Sitting 51st in FIFA's world rankings, the Central American side has struggled in their last two fixtures, suffering a 5–0 defeat to Iran in March before going down 3–1 to Colombia the previous week.

What's Next for England?
The 2026 World Cup is just around the corner, with Mexico set to face South Africa at the Estadio Azteca in a rematch of the iconic 2010 tournament opener.
England kick off their campaign against familiar opponents Croatia in Dallas next Wednesday. The Three Lions then take on Ghana on June 23 at Gillette Stadium in Foxborough, Mass., before wrapping up the group stage against Costa Rica's regional rivals, Panama.
